That was the case at one point..we were replicating to one node and have shifted over replication to a different node. Logs and MV's have been recreated since then and since noticing this issue. I think the 8 million row count came from a couple of failed refreshes, but what concerns me most is the mlog have a higher row count than the table and it's only an issue on one log...the other row counts are inline with the table have more rows.
